History:
Hillcrest Baptist Church was founded in 1912 as Palatka Heights Baptist Church. The present building was constructed in the 1950s and the name changed to Hillcrest at that time. The church stands strongly for scriptural doctrine on missions, and is an active member of the St. Johns River Baptist Association.
